What is Volatility?

Volatility is a measure of the risk involved in playing a particular slot game. It is often expressed as a mathematical formula that calculates the variability of a game’s payouts over a certain period of time. Games with high volatility tend to have larger payouts, but these payouts are less frequent and less predictable. On the other hand, games with low volatility have smaller but more frequent payouts, making them a safer option for players who prefer a more consistent experience.
There are three main levels of volatility that online slot games can fall into: low, medium, and high. Low volatility games are characterized by small but frequent payouts, while high volatility games offer the potential for larger payouts, but these payouts are less frequent and more unpredictable. Medium volatility games fall somewhere in between, offering a balance between risk and reward.
Players should consider their own risk tolerance and gaming preferences when choosing which level of volatility to play. Those who enjoy the thrill of chasing big wins and are willing to accept the risk of losing their bankroll quickly may prefer high volatility games. On the other hand, players who prefer a more consistent experience and are looking to stretch their bankroll as far as possible may opt for low volatility games.

Tips for Responsible and Balanced Gaming Behavior

In addition to understanding the volatility of slot games, there are several other strategies that players can use to promote responsible and balanced gaming behavior. Here are some tips to help you stay in control while enjoying online slot games:

  • Set a budget and stick to it: Before you start playing, decide how much money you are willing to spend and stick to that budget. Avoid chasing losses or increasing your bets to recoup your losses.
  • Take breaks: It’s important to take regular breaks while playing slot games to avoid fatigue and keep a clear head. Taking breaks can also help you maintain a healthy balance between gaming and other activities.
  • Keep track of your play: Keep a record of your wins and losses while playing slot games to help you track your progress and identify any potential issues. This can also help you make better decisions about when to stop playing.
  • Use responsible gaming tools: Many online casinos offer responsible gaming tools, such as deposit limits, time limits, and self-exclusion options. Take advantage of these tools to help you stay in control of your gaming behavior.
  • Seek help if needed: If you feel that your gaming behavior is becoming problematic or addictive, don’t hesitate to seek help from a professional counselor or therapist. There are many resources available to help you manage your gaming habits and get back on track.

By understanding the volatility of online slot games and practicing responsible gaming behavior, players can enjoy a safe and enjoyable gaming experience while minimizing the risks involved. Remember to stay informed, set limits, and always play responsibly.
